Final Rule: Transportation of Household Goods in Interstate Commerce; Consumer Protection Regulations

NOTE: The item below may be impacted by a more recently published rulemaking or notice. View Related Rulemakings for more information.

Federal Register: 77FR 36932
RIN: 2126-AB52
Docket #: FMCSA-2012-0119
(What is this?)
49 CFR Part: 375
 
Publication Date: 6/20/2012
Effective Date: 8/20/2012
Comment By Date: 7/20/2012

Action:

Final rule

Summary:

The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) amends the regulations governing the transportation of household goods to remove an obsolete requirement related to collect calls, resolve ambiguities, and reduce a regulatory burden on household goods motor carriers.
